Transaction 8c20d6682e528fd0ba08dc6a846e9c60069fe7886505a4feb262ce66f913e8a8
1 Input
1 Output
-
8c20d6682e528fd0ba08dc6a846e9c60069fe7886505a4feb262ce66f913e8a8:0
- value
- 11086846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aab43861dd23501de383d9cc9d1b106cb113906 OP_EQUAL
- address
- 38Vq6MVsKWhJADHMuE27dbTRAgVaoXtCV6